So, tonight we went over to the local GAA pitch with a kettle bell each and a disc and did 3 rounds of the following circuit. Nothing too taxing but we threw 10 throws each as an active rest element between each station. I quite enjoyed it and it worked out quite well time wise too - sub 60 mins including warm up. I think if I was to do it again I'd maybe double the numbers to up the intensity but for the first time out in maybe a month it was grand.

Circuit (Everything was x10):

Explosive Push-ups
Active Rest(AR) 10 F/H
KB Dead lifts L&R
AR 10 B/H
Squat Jumps
AR 10 Hammers
Knee Pushes L&R
AR 10 F/H
KB Swings L&R
AR 10 B/H
KB Snatch L&R
AR 10 Hammers

I really had to concentrate on technique for the last 30 throws but out of the 180 catches there were only 3 drops (all hammers and 2 in the last set). That's less than 2% which is acceptable. I'd love to walk away from every throwing/training session with a 98% completion rate :)
